This question comes up at the start of almost every ERP project, and it is usually answered the wrong way round.
The most common mistake runs in reverse: standard inventory accounting gets built from scratch, while the company's genuinely distinctive process is squeezed into an off-the-shelf template. Both cost money and time.
The short answer
One question decides it: does this process set you apart from competitors? If it does not, configure a ready system - three to four weeks and $7,000–12,000. If it does, build from scratch - fourteen to sixteen weeks and from $70,000. In most companies the answer is mixed: a ready core with one or two custom modules.
The question that decides it
Split your processes into three categories.
Standard processes. Payroll, cash handling, document flow, attendance. These are almost identical across companies and nobody competes on them. Building them from scratch is money spent for nothing.
Industry processes. Production norms, weighbridge control, warehouse structure. Similar within an industry, different outside it. A system built for your industry works here.
Your advantage. How you serve a client, how you calculate a price, how you assemble an order. If that process is what sets you apart in the market, do not force it into a template.
Configuring a ready system
3-4 weeks · $7,000-12,000
- The system already runs and has been proven in practice
- Lower risk - you can see the result before you commit
- Other companies' experience is built into it
- Constraint: you adapt to its existing logic
- New features arrive more slowly
Building from scratch
14-16 weeks · $70,000-90,000
- Everything is built around your way of working
- The process does not change - the system adapts
- Full control and unlimited extension
- Higher risk - the result appears at the end
- Three to five times more expensive and slower
The mixed option, which is the most common
In practice, for most companies the right answer sits in the middle.
The core comes from a ready system: inventory, cash, payroll, reporting. These are standard, and spending time on them makes no sense. On top of that, your own distinctive module is built from scratch.
Take a metal forming plant. Inventory, sales and payroll are ready-made. Cutting plan optimisation and waste accounting are custom, because that is exactly where the plant makes or loses money.
This approach cuts the price by a factor of two or three and shortens the timeline.
The decision matrix
Assess four factors. If three point towards ready-made, take the ready system.
| Factor | Ready system | Custom build |
|---|---|---|
| How distinctive the process is | Standard | A competitive advantage |
| Budget | $7,000–35,000 | From $70,000 |
| Timeline | Needed in 3-4 weeks | Can wait four months |
| Internal IT team | None or small | Exists and will run the system |
Budget and timeline are often decisive. If the system is needed in three months, the custom option does not exist.
The hidden costs of a ready system
Ready-made does not always mean cheaper. Costs appear in three places.
- Adapting your process to the system requires retraining staff
- Every additional feature you need is a separately paid change request
- Dependency on the system owner if they raise prices or shut down
- In a multi-tenant system your request sits in a shared queue
- Difficulty of migrating data out later if you change direction
So when you evaluate a ready system, ask: who owns the code and the database, what happens if the system stops, and what an additional module costs.
The hidden costs of building from scratch
The other side has costs too, and they are usually left out.
Support. In a ready system it is priced in and shared across other clients. In a custom system support is yours alone - $300 to $2,000 a month.
Defects. New code always ships with defects. A ready system has been tested across dozens of companies; yours is tested only at yours.
Time. Four months is not simply waiting. Throughout it you keep working the old way, and the losses continue.
The most expensive mistake
Choosing a custom build and then asking for "the same thing the ready system does". That combines the worst of both options: you pay development prices and receive a copy of an existing product. If the ready system appeals to you, take the ready system.
How to test the decision
There are two practical steps before committing.
1. See the ready system running. Not a demo - a live system with real users. Talk to a client in your industry. Often at this point it becomes clear that the system covers eighty per cent of your process and the remaining twenty per cent does not matter.
2. Run a discovery stage. Two weeks, process analysis and a written document. At the end of it the choice becomes a calculation rather than an assumption. It costs $3,500 and it is needed either way.
In summary
The question is not technical, it is commercial: does this process set you apart or not.
A practical order:
- Split your processes into three categories: standard, industry, your advantage
- Consider a custom build only for the third category
- Cost the mixed option - a ready core with a custom advantage module
- Before choosing a ready system, see it running in real conditions
- Start with a discovery stage either way
